Transaction fc64bc70b2903fc602a3b20f4cf9761f206431d6a9553841e9a67fd35995b85d
1 Input
1 Output
-
fc64bc70b2903fc602a3b20f4cf9761f206431d6a9553841e9a67fd35995b85d:0
- value
- 243611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75ca602caceb57222e27a6b0243c6be63c9baaec OP_EQUAL
- address
- 3CRqRJAecRotqz7tWznSd4eAkJRH4kf1t6